“COLORES” Lyrics by Luis Brown is a latest Spanish song in the voice of Luis Brown. Its music too is composed by singer while brand new “COLORES” song lyrics are also written by Luis Brown. This is a popular song among the people of United States of America. The song “COLORES” by Luis Brown is about living with style, confidence, and charm. He talks about his flashy fashion, street life, and how he’s been standing out since he was a kid. He wants to be with a beautiful girl who likes him for his vibe and energy. The lyrics also touch on fun times, luxury, and being real, with a mix of romantic and bold street talk.
